PRP Shows Benefit for Hamstring Injuries

Hamstring injuries some of the most common injuries in athletes.  Despite aggressive conservative treatments, it can take a few months to be able to return to play and several months to fully recover.  A new article in the American Journal of Sports Medicine shows potential benefit in treating acute hamstring injuries (Grade 2a).  Using a single PRP injection combined with a rehabilitation program was found to be significantly more effective in treating hamstring injuries than a rehabilitation program alone.  Athletes were able to return to play on average in 27 days in those treated with PRP compared to 43 days in those who underwent physical therapy alone.
